Best Times to Visit Moone

When should you plan your Cabin Rentals stay?

To make the most of your stay here, consider planning your vacation during the ideal seasons when the region offers its best weather and local events, ensuring a memorable experience in this destination’s peaceful surroundings.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, you'll experience the warmest weather here, making it ideal for outdoor activities and exploring the region's scenic countryside.

Average Temperature Daytime: 18-22°C - Nighttime: 10-14°C
autumn
Autumn (September to November)

This season offers mild temperatures and stunning fall foliage, perfect for enjoying tranquil walks and the natural beauty of the area.

Average Temperature Daytime: 14-19°C - Nighttime: 8-12°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(December to February)

The quiet winter period allows for a peaceful retreat with cooler temperatures, ideal for cozy stays in this destination’s tranquil surroundings.

Average Temperature Daytime: 6-9°C - Nighttime: 2-4°C
image
Spring (March to May)

In early spring, you can enjoy fewer crowds and the emergence of fresh greenery, creating a refreshing atmosphere for your visit.

Average Temperature Daytime: 10-15°C - Nighttime: 3-7°C
